About the series
In Souvenirs de L'empire de l'Atome, Thierry Smolderen and Alexandre Clérisse craft a singular, atmospheric one-shot for Dargaud that reimagines a retro-futuristic 1950s France through the lens of atomic-age nostalgia and espionage. This standalone graphic novel (2013–present) blends elegant ligne claire art with a quietly haunting story of memory, identity, and the lingering shadows of a lost empire. It stands as a distinctive, self-contained work from two of modern French comics' most thoughtful storytellers.
